Tubular centrifuges stand out for their unique design, which allows for a higher centrifugal force compared to traditional separators. This force enables them to effectively separate liquids from solids, making them invaluable in processes where product purity and yield are critical. In 2025, we can expect a surge in the integration of smart technologies within tubular centrifuges. Increased automation and IoT connectivity will allow for real-time monitoring and control, enhancing operational efficiency. This capability will not only improve production rates but also reduce waste, allowing companies to achieve more sustainable practices. The ability to gather and analyze data will help operators optimize their processes, ensuring the highest levels of performance and compliance with industry standards.

Another exciting trend forecasted for 2025 is the development of energy-efficient tubular centrifuge models. As industries strive to reduce their carbon footprints, the demand for energy-efficient machinery will continue to rise. Manufacturers are likely to focus on designing centrifuges that require less energy while maintaining or even improving separation efficiency. This shift not only aligns with global sustainability goals but also offers businesses a chance to cut operational costs.

In addition, companies in the tubular centrifuge market are expected to prioritize the adoption of ergonomic designs. Technological advancements will lead to machines that are easier to operate and maintain, enhancing safety protocols and minimizing downtime. User-friendly interfaces that require minimal training will further contribute to efficient operations, allowing businesses to focus on productivity rather than troubleshooting machinery.

The pharmaceutical and biotechnology sectors are particularly poised to benefit from advancements in tubular centrifuge technologies. As these industries face increasing demand for high-quality products and stringent regulatory requirements, having reliable and efficient separation equipment is essential. Tubular centrifuges can help streamline the manufacturing process by providing consistent and reproducible results, which is critical for ensuring compliance with safety and quality standards.

Looking ahead, the market for tubular centrifuges is not only expanding but diversifying. Manufacturers are likely to explore new applications for these machines, such as in the treatment of wastewater or in the recovery of valuable materials from industrial byproducts. These developments could open up new markets and revenue streams, positioning tubular centrifuges as a key technology in resource recovery and environmental stewardship.
